Common Cold Room Door Problems and Fixes

Cold room doors are crucial for maintaining the right temperature in storage facilities. But, like anything else, they can run into issues. Have you ever noticed a door that just won’t close properly? Or maybe it doesn’t seal well, causing cold air to escape. These problems can lead to energy loss and spoilage of stored goods. Let’s dive into some common problems and their fixes.

One major issue is the door seal. If the seal is worn out or damaged, it can cause cold air to leak. This not only affects the temperature inside but also increases energy costs. To fix this, inspect the seal regularly. If you notice cracks or wear, replace the seal. It’s a simple fix that can save you a lot of money in the long run.

Another common problem is hinge issues. If the door doesn’t swing smoothly, it could be due to rust or dirt buildup on the hinges. Regular maintenance is key here. Clean the hinges and apply lubricant to ensure smooth operation. If the hinges are damaged, replacing them can restore functionality.

Sometimes, the door might not latch properly. This can happen if the latch mechanism is misaligned. Check the alignment and adjust it as needed. If adjustments don’t work, consider replacing the latch. A secure latch is essential for keeping the cold air in and the warm air out.

In some cases, the door might be too heavy for the frame. If you notice sagging or difficulty in closing, it might be time to evaluate the door’s weight. You can add additional support or even replace the door with a lighter option. Remember, a well-functioning door is vital for energy efficiency.

Lastly, always keep an eye out for frost buildup. This can indicate poor sealing or humidity issues. If you see frost, it’s time to check the door’s seal and the room’s humidity levels. Addressing these factors promptly can prevent larger problems down the line.

In summary, keeping your cold room doors in top shape is essential. Regular inspections and maintenance can prevent many common issues. By taking these simple steps, you can ensure optimal performance and energy efficiency in your cold storage environment.
